Python Program to Find Slope of a Line

Given two points of a line, the task is to find the slope of a given line.

Let  A(x1,y1) and B(x2,y2) are the two points on a straight line.

Formula :

Formula to find the slope of a given line is:

slope=(y2-y1)/(x2-x1)

Examples:

Example1:

Input:

Given First Point = ( 5, 3  ) 
Given Second Point = ( 1, 2 )

Output:

The slope of the line for the given two points is :
0.25

Example2:

Input:

Given First Point = ( 5, 1 ) 
Given Second Point = ( 6, 2 )

Output:

The slope of the line for the given two points is :
1.0

Program to Find Slope of a Line in Python

Below are the ways to find the slope of a given line in python:

Method #1: Using Mathematical Formula (Static Input)

Approach:

  • Give the first point as static input and store it in two variables.
  • Give the second point as static input and store it in another two variables.
  • Pass the given two points of a line i.e, a1, a2, b1, b2, as the arguments to the Find_Slope() function.
  • Create a function to say Find_Slope() which takes the given two points of a line i.e, a1, a2, b1, b2 as the arguments and returns the slope of the given line.
  • Inside the function, calculate the slope of the line with the given two points using the above mathematical formula and convert it into float using the float() function.
  • Store it in a variable.
  • Return the above result i.e, the slope of the line.
  • The Exit of the Program.

Below is the implementation:

# Create a function to say Find_Slope() which takes the given two points of a line i.e,
# a1, a2, b1, b2 as the arguments and returns the slope of the given line.


def Find_Slope(a1, a2, b1, b2):
    # Inside the function, calculate the slope of the line with the given two points
    # using the above mathematical formula and convert it into float using the
    # float() function.

    # Store it in a variable.
    rslt_slope = (float)(b2-b1)/(a2-a1)
    # Return the above result i.e, the slope of the line.
    return rslt_slope


# Give the first point as static input and store it in two variables.
a1 = 5
b1 = 3
# Give the second point as static input and store it in another two variables.
a2 = 1
b2 = 2
print("The slope of the line for the given two points is :")
# Pass the given two points of a line i.e, a1, a2, b1, b2, as the arguments to the
# Find_Slope() function.
print(Find_Slope(a1, a2, b1, b2))

Output:

The slope of the line for the given two points is :
0.25

Method #2: Using Mathematical Formula (User Input)

Approach:

  • Give the first point as user input using map(),int(),split() functions and store it in two variables.
  • Give the second point as user input using map(),int(),split() functions and store it in two variables.
  • Pass the given two points of a line i.e, a1, a2, b1, b2, as the arguments to the Find_Slope() function.
  • Create a function to say Find_Slope() which takes the given two points of a line i.e, a1, a2, b1, b2 as the arguments and returns the slope of the given line.
  • Inside the function, calculate the slope of the line with the given two points using the above mathematical formula and convert it into float using the float() function.
  • Store it in a variable.
  • Return the above result i.e, the slope of the line.
  • The Exit of the Program.

Below is the implementation:

# Create a function to say Find_Slope() which takes the given two points of a line i.e,
# a1, a2, b1, b2 as the arguments and returns the slope of the given line.


def Find_Slope(a1, a2, b1, b2):
    # Inside the function, calculate the slope of the line with the given two points
    # using the above mathematical formula and convert it into float using the
    # float() function.

    # Store it in a variable.
    rslt_slope = (float)(b2-b1)/(a2-a1)
    # Return the above result i.e, the slope of the line.
    return rslt_slope


# Give the first point as user input using map(),int(),split() functions
# and store it in two variables.
a1, b1 = map(int, input(
    'Enter some random first point values separated by spaces = ').split())
# Give the second point as user input using map(),int(),split() functions
# and store it in two variables.
a2, b2 = map(int, input(
    'Enter some random second point values separated by spaces = ').split())
print("The slope of the line for the given two points is :")
# Pass the given two points of a line i.e, a1, a2, b1, b2, as the arguments to the
# Find_Slope() function.
print(Find_Slope(a1, a2, b1, b2))

Output:

Enter some random first point values separated by spaces = 5 1
Enter some random second point values separated by spaces = 6 2
The slope of the line for the given two points is :
1.0
